Ingredients List for Spicy Southwest Chicken Salad
To create this wonderful salad, you will need the following ingredients:
- 2 grilled chicken breasts, sliced
- 4 cups mixed lettuce
- 1 avocado, diced
- 1 cup cherry tomatoes, halved
- 1 cup corn (fresh or canned)
- 1 cup black beans, rinsed and drained
- 1 cup tortilla strips
- 1/2 cup spicy ranch dressing
How To Make Spicy Southwest Chicken Salad Step-by-Step
Step 1: Prepare the Base
In a large salad bowl, combine the mixed lettuce, cherry tomatoes, corn, and black beans.
Step 2: Add Protein and Creaminess
Top the salad with the sliced grilled chicken and diced avocado.
Step 3: Dress It Up
Drizzle the spicy ranch dressing over the top.
Step 4: Add Crunch
Add tortilla strips for crunch.
Step 5: Toss and Serve
Toss everything together gently before serving.

How To Store Spicy Southwest Chicken Salad
-
Refrigerate: Store any leftovers in an airtight container in the fridge for up to three days.
-
Keep Dressing Separate: To maintain freshness, store the dressing separately until you are ready to eat.
-
Avoid sogginess: If possible, store the ingredients separately to help prevent the salad from becoming soggy.
-
Use a Salad Spinner: If you wash your lettuce before assembly, use a salad spinner to remove excess water before mixing.
-
Label and Date: If you’re meal prepping, label the containers with the date to keep track of how fresh they are.

FAQs About Spicy Southwest Chicken Salad
-
Can I use canned chicken?
Yes, canned chicken can work, but fresh or grilled chicken provides better flavor. -
Is this salad suitable for meal prep?
Absolutely! Just store it in separate containers and combine when you’re ready to eat. -
How can I make this vegetarian?
Skip the chicken and double up on black beans or add more veggies. -
What can I use instead of spicy ranch dressing?
You can use regular ranch, yogurt dressing, or even a lime vinaigrette for a lighter option.
